Aston Villa, West Ham United and Newcastle United are reportedly interested in signing Angers midfielder Baptiste Santamaria.

Aston Villa have reportedly joined the race to sign Angers midfielder Baptiste Santamaria during the January transfer window.

After a poor run of form in the Premier League, manager Dean Smith is considering his options with regards to strengthening his squad.

According to L'Equipe, Santamaria has emerged as a potential addition having impressed for Angers in France's top flight.

The defensive-minded player has been an ever-present in Ligue 1 this season, contributing one goal and one assist from his 19 starts.

West Ham United and Newcastle United are also said to be monitoring the situation, although it may take a significant offer to convince Angers into a sale with Santamaria still having two-and-a-half years left on his contract.
